Roof covering underlayment is a water-proof or waterproof product laid straight on a roofing system deck prior to any type of other roof materials are set up.


If you want the most safe, most waterproof roof covering, make sure to consist of underlayment in your installation. Avoiding water infiltration before it ends up being a leak is always much easier than taking care of pricey fixings or damages. There are three different sorts of underlayment, a few of which are much more suitable for sure roof.


Asphalt-saturated felt is commonly attached to the roof with staples. It functions well on considerably sloped roofs where water quickly streams down right into the rain gutters, but it should not be used on low-slope roofs where water is extra most likely to pool and penetrate the underlayment.

It's additionally not rather as durable, which can be a little a barrier during the roof covering procedure, as the installers stroll about on the roof covering, and may tear with the underlayment with an also hefty of an action. Most expert roofers prefer dealing with synthetic underlayment. This underlayment includes an artificial base that is saturated in asphalt and then coated with fiberglass to make it additional secure and immune to rips.




It is likewise extremely flexible, water resistant, sturdy, immune to UV rays and mold and mildew, and helps the roofing take a breath far better than really felt paper. While this is one of the more expensive kinds of underlayment, it supplies one of the most defense. Rubberized asphalt underlayment has rubber and asphalt polymers that function to make it added water-proof.

Since tiles overlap, they're vulnerable to raise when hit by strong winds, making them vulnerable to blow-off and water breach. If a major storm breaks your tiles loose, you can depend on underlayment to keep snow, ice, and rainfall from permeating the roofing system deck and entering your home. If you live in a snowy environment, your roofing is at threat of developing ice dams.


If melted snow diminishes your roofing, it can refreeze over your roofing's boundary and form ice dams. When snow or ice on your roofing melts, the water can seep right into any type of openings in the ceiling, triggering leakages, water damage, and mold. The waterproof underlayment will secure around the frame and guarantee the water drains pipes off the roof.

(https://www.bitchute.com/channel/HIlxP2iMDK51)Roof covering sheathing, additionally recognized as roofing system decking, is a strong layer of timber boards that are dealt with to your roof's joists and trusses and add assistance. Your roofer will certainly affix your shingles to these squares or slabs of wood. There are 2 sorts of roofing system sheathing. It's made from either oriented hair board (OSB) or plywood.


Plywood is an extremely sturdy sort of roof decking however often tends to cost a little bit more and is much heavier. Most roofing professionals these days favor OSB, unless they're collaborating with a larger product like slate or concrete roof covering ceramic tiles - storm damage repair gainesville ga. In these instances, plywood is usually a better alternative. The key feature of roof sheathing is to enhance your roof.


In enhancement to adding strength to your roofing, roof covering sheathing supplies an array of benefits! A lot of homeowners located that without sheathing or decking, their roofings were a lot extra most likely to leakage.

Roof covering sheathing or decking can likewise aid stop fires. While nothing is 100% fire-resistant, many roofing system sheathing products come with a fire resistant therapy that can assist withstand fires on the roofing system or in the attic. Roof covering sheathing is an important element of your overall roof. If your own is old, obsolete, or damaged, you'll wish to have it changed as soon as possible.


Rotting sheathing is commonly brought on by water damage, yet it can be less evident if you have not yet seen leakages. The most effective means to check for rotting sheathing is to direct to your attic with a flashlight. If sheathing has actually started to rot in position, you ought to be able to see darkened places in the wood.
